I leave mine open most of the time, but regardless, it shouldn't be TOO hard of a fix. Follow the instructions to install the short shifter into our car. It'll say how to get the piece off that the cover is a part of, I believe. From there, it's probably just a spring that came out of place. My "not an ashtray" cover did this once and a simple repositioning of the spring fixed it right up.

the cd cover tray, not an ashtry, and the cup holder has pretty much the same scheme in design, broke not an ash tray , and cd cover tray once, not hard to fix get some krazy glue and just find whatever is broken (usually the index tab that follows the "maze" and glue it back together all done =]
